How Do Roof Shapes Impact the Way Homes Look and Function in Hudson, NY?
Roof shapes play a central role in both the appearance and practicality of a home in Hudson, NY. The silhouette of a roof can define a neighborhood’s character, influence how a house handles local weather, and affect everything from attic space to energy use. Residents exploring renovations or repairs often find that even simple changes in roof form can result in big differences—sometimes in ways not immediately expected.
Why Are Certain Roof Shapes More Common in the Hudson Area?
The roof styles seen throughout Hudson are often the result of historical trends, climate adaptations, and building regulations. Most local homes feature gabled or hipped roofs; these have proven effective at shedding snow and rain through the region’s variable seasons.
Many houses, especially those built in the 19th and early 20th centuries, reflect styles suited to managing snow load and wind. For example:
- Gable roofs have two sloping sides that meet at a ridge, making it easy for precipitation to run off before it builds up.
- Hip roofs, which slope on all four sides, offer even greater stability in high winds and resist damage during heavy winter storms.
Modern builds sometimes experiment with flat or low-sloped designs, but these typically require additional engineering and maintenance to prevent leaks and withstand the freeze-thaw cycles common in the area.
Does Roof Shape Affect Energy Efficiency or Heating in Local Homes?
In Hudson, roof shape can have a notable effect on energy use, especially during the fluctuating temperatures of spring and fall, and the cold winters.
A steep gable roof allows for more attic insulation, which can help retain warmth inside. In contrast, flat or low-sloped roofs may have less attic space, requiring alternative insulation methods to prevent heat loss.
Ventilation is also impacted by roof form. Traditional venting systems—such as ridge and soffit vents—work best with sloped roofs. Poor ventilation can lead to condensation and ice damming, a common winter hazard in the region. Residents sometimes underestimate how much roof shape determines the long-term comfort and efficiency of their homes.
How Do Roof Shapes Change Interior Space and Layout?
Roof design doesn’t just influence the exterior; it changes the way a home can be used inside.
- Gable and gambrel roofs often allow for large, open attics that can be finished for extra rooms or storage.
- Mansard roofs, with their dual-sloped sides, are sometimes chosen to create a full upper floor without raising the building’s total height.
- Flat roofs, while providing modern aesthetics, limit above-ceiling space and typically offer only mechanical or minimal storage areas.
These differences matter for residents considering upper-floor renovations. It’s common to find that adding dormers or converting attics is simpler for homes with steep-pitched roofs than with flat or complex rooflines.
What Aesthetic Impacts Should Residents Consider?
Roof shape does far more than protect against the weather—it sets a tone for the entire property. In older neighborhoods of Hudson, traditional styles like gable and hip roofs create a sense of continuity and historical authenticity. Deviating from these forms too much can sometimes clash with the architectural language of surrounding homes.
However, unique roof shapes—such as butterfly or gambrel roofs—can be used thoughtfully for visual impact, particularly in renovations or infill houses. Area design guidelines or homeowners’ association rules may limit how much individuality is practical, but there’s still room to reflect personal tastes. Even small changes to roof pitch or overhang depth can meaningfully alter a home’s curb appeal.
Are There Local Regulations That Affect Roof Design Options?
Hudson’s zoning codes, historic preservation rules, and building ordinances may influence which roof shapes are allowed, especially in the city’s older neighborhoods or in homes near the historic district.
Restrictions sometimes specify roofing material, maximum building height (measured to the roof peak or mid-point), or even the angle of roof slopes. These regulations aim to balance homeowners’ freedom with the need to preserve local heritage and community resilience to weather events.
Before planning major changes, residents usually check with the city’s permitting office or consult local planning documents to ensure their project aligns with current guidelines.
How Do Hudson’s Weather Patterns Interact With Roof Design?

The region’s four-season climate places consistent demands on roofing. Roofs in the area must manage:
- Snow accumulation and freeze-thaw cycles in winter
- Heavy seasonal rainfall
- Intense summer sun
Steeply pitched roofs (such as gable, hip, or even mansard forms) perform reliably, allowing snow and water to slide off. Flat or modern low-slope roofs are possible, but typically require robust drainage systems and durable materials to prevent pooling water or ice buildup.
Older homes may need updated flashing and ice-and-water shield systems, particularly if the roof shape was originally designed for milder conditions than are currently experienced.
Common Misconceptions About Roof Shape and Function
New homeowners sometimes believe that any roof style will work equally well if built properly. In practice, the match between local climate and roof shape is crucial. For example:
- Flat roofs are often chosen for their modern look but can be more vulnerable to leaks unless meticulously maintained, especially in snowy environments.
- Gambrel and mansard roofs offer attractive additional space, but require care to prevent snow loading stress and ice dams at the eaves.
- Overhangs can make a big difference in protecting siding and windows, but some styles naturally provide more shelter than others.
Residents also occasionally assume that upgrades like solar panels or rooftop gardens can be added to any house. The best candidates for such projects often have a particular type or orientation of roof, so early design decisions have long-term consequences.
Practical Examples in Hudson Neighborhoods
Throughout the city, examples abound of different roof shapes meeting specific needs. Queen Anne homes display complex multi-gabled roofs, maximizing sunlight and rain handling. Colonial and Dutch influences show up in gambrel roofs, allowing for roomy upper floors. More recently, contemporary homes experiment with flat or single-slope forms, creating striking skylines but relying on advances in material science to remain weather-tight.
What works on a quiet residential street might not suit houses near open fields or steep hills, where wind and drifting snow can create extra challenges.
